What does cacoon mean?

cacoon meaning in General Dictionary

one of many seeds or big beans of a tropical vine Entada scandens used for making purses aroma containers an such like

View more

  • One of the seeds or huge beans of a tropical vine (Entada scandens) utilized for making purses, fragrance containers, etc.

cacoon meaning in Etymology Dictionary

big, level bean from an African shrub, 1854, from some African term.